What size is the dishwasher connection on a garbage disposal?

All garbage disposal models come with a dishwasher inlet which is basically a small 7/8 inch size (outer diameter) pipe extending from it. The outlet hose from the dishwasher is connected to it, so the food debris coming through it passes through the garbage disposal.

Do you need an air gap for a dishwasher if you have a garbage disposal?

When there is a garbage disposal installed, the dishwasher drain line should run down from the air gap or high loop and connect to a side nipple on the disposal, where it connects with a hose clamp. Do not bypass the garbage disposal if it is present.

Is it better to connect dishwasher to garbage disposal?

It is recommended to connect it with garbage disposal because as the dishwasher pumps the discarded water and leftover food particles in the garbage disposal, the garbage disposal can grind the food particle and push them down the drain.

Can you use your dishwasher if your garbage disposal is broken?

If, for example, your disposal is broken, as in an electrical or mechanical problem, you can still run the dishwasher. It’s the garbage disposal drain system that can keep the dishwasher from draining properly.

Does a dishwasher drain hose need a loop?

“A high loop is required on the dishwasher drain in the installation instructions for all of your dishwashers. GE: “If an air gap is not required, the drain hose must have the high loop from the floor to prevent backflow of water into the dishwasher or water siphoning out during operation.”

Why is water coming out of my dishwasher air gap?

When the dishwasher is discharging water, a lot of water floods out of the air gap. When the gap leaks, it is normally due to a kink or blockage in the tube from the air gap to the tail piece (drain line) below the sink. The gap may need to be cleaned, or the drain line below the sink may be plugged.

How do you connect a dishwasher to a garbage disposal?

Connect the trimmed dishwasher drain into the small side of the air gap with a hose clamp. The large end of the air gap is then connected down to the garbage disposal with a 7/8-inch rubber hose.

Where is the drain plug on a dishwasher?

Usually located near the top of the unit is a drainage port where the dishwasher’s drainage tube gets attached. If this tube is attached already, disconnect it using the appropriate screwdriver for the job. Inside the garbage disposal, behind this tube mount, is where the knockout plug lives.
